ADSSL1 Antibody (PA5-25767) in IHC (P)

Immunohistochemistry analysis of ADSSL1 in formalin fixed and paraffin embedded human skeletal muscle. Samples were incubated with ADSSL1 polyclonal antibody (Product # PA5-25767) followed by peroxidase conjugation of the secondary antibody and DAB staining. This data demonstrates the use of this antibody for immunohistochemistry. Clinical relevance has not been evaluated. {{ $ctrl.currentElement.advancedVerification.fullName }} validation info. Product Specific Information

This antibody is predicted to react with bovine and porcine based on sequence homology.

Target Information

ADSSL1 is a muscle isozyme of adenylosuccinate synthase (EC 6.3.4.4), which catalyzes the initial reaction in the conversion of inosine monophosphate (IMP) to adenosine monophosphate (AMP).
